About the ART
use a variety of hot roll steel ranging from sheets, square bar, flat bar, etc. The steel is worked into shape by hand and/or with the aid of machines. Both mig and tig welding for assembly depending on the piece. A combination of chemicals and paint are used to achieve depth and patina.

About the ARTIST
I am inspired by mid century architecture in the small shore town of Wildwood where I grew up. I like to play around with materials as if they are building blocks that I can manipulate into something grander. I experiment with unique chemical patina processes to create depth and warmth.
